  • Patent number: 5457980
    Abstract: A cushioning apparatus for applying a blank-holding force to a pressure member to hold a blank on a press, through hydraulic cylinders on a cushion platen biased by a force generating device toward the pressure member, and cushion pins linked with the cylinders and supporting the pressure member, the blank-holding force being based on a biasing force generated by the force generating device, and controllable by a controller through a flow regulator provided in a discharge line for discharging the fluid from the cylinders, such that the controller controls the flow regulator to discharge the fluid from the cylinders during a pressing action on the blank by upper and lower dies, for thereby controlling the cylinder pressure according to a predetermined pattern of change in the pressure in relation to a downward movement of the upper die. The hydraulic cylinders may be classified into two or more groups connected to mutually independent discharge lines.
